Abstract

The latest development of deepfake technology has had a significant influence on the creation and distribution of content on online media. It brings all kinds of possibilities, particularly in the area of false information, therefore it also presents significant challenges. Deepfake content, involving the use of artificial intelligence to create super-realistic but fake videos and images, can potentially deceive the audience and manipulate public opinion. Based on these phenomena, the paper explores three major topics— technology background of deepfake, content differences between deepfake and traditional forgery, and the impact of deepfake content on public trust. The paper also provides three specific examples in different areas (Politics, Entertainment, and News Media) to help people understand the relationship between deepfake content and public trust.
